New row over Metro carshed site flares up between Centre, Maharashtra

Environment and Tourism Minister Aditya Thackeray has reiterated that the land belongs to the state government and Shiv Sena Mayor Kishori Pednekar alleged that a conspiracy was being hatched against the state

A fresh row has erupted between the Centre and Maharashtra government on Tuesday over the latter's decision to shift the Mumbai Metro carshed project from Aarey Colony to the Kanjurmarg site.

The Centre's Department of Promotion of Industry & Internal Trade (DPIIT) has written to the state government, saying the construction of the carshed on the Kanjurmarg site would be "against the interest of the Government of India", and claimed ownership of the 102 acre land here.
